This August Majmua Theatre & Oxzygen Koncepts bring to Terra Kulture stage the dynamic duo of Bimbo Akintola and Toyin Oshinaike in Tyrone Terrence’s “A Husband’s Wife” Directed by Abiodun Kassim produced by special arrangement with Rosewood Theatre
Produced by Zara Udofia – Ejoh and Zaynab Ikaz – Kassim
A Husbands wife is a drama filled story of a husband going through midlife crisis and his wife having to deal with it.
How far will a man go to reclaim his youth? how far will a wife go to reclaim her husband?
The play takes the audience through the dramatic journey of this couple

The playwright, Tyrone E. Terrence was born in Jamaica to a Jamaican father and Nigerian mother. He attended the University of Lagos. He now lives in Abuja and manages Rosewood Media Inc. Theatre Company. He has written over 20 plays, including Private Lies, A Husband’s Wife and A Pound of Flesh.
A writer/director and producer with many plays, documentaries and short films to his credit, his plays have featured the likes of Joke Silva, Richard Mofe-Damijo, Dede Mabiaku and Genevieve Nnaji among others and have been performed all over the world. He has also worked with the BBC World Trust Service as a writer/director and script editor, joining other creative minds from around the world to create and write the hit radio soap Story Story and as yet unequalled TV series Wetin Dey. Tyrone is the writer, director and producer of the TV series Living Large and Stitches and most recently produced and directed two radio plays for UNICEF in Akwa Ibom and Cross River States
